diff --git a/package.json b/package.json index 2b91024..ddb5826 100644 --- a/package.json +++ b/package.json @@ -107,7 +107,7 @@ "typescript": "^4.2.4" }, "dependencies": { - "atom-languageclient": "^1.10.0", + "atom-languageclient": "^1.14.1", "atom-package-deps": "^7.2.3", "fs-extra": "^10.0.0", "semver": "^7.3.5" di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 9ac3f38..2d8ccf0 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-8,7 +8,7 @@ specifiers: '@types/node': ^15.6.0 '@types/semver': ^7.3.6 atom-jasmine3-test-runner: ^5.2.6 - atom-languageclient: ^1.10.0 + atom-languageclient: ^1.14.1 atom-package-deps: ^7.2.3 build-commit: 0.1.4 cross-env: 7.0.3 @@ -24,7 +24,7 @@ specifiers: typescript: ^4.2.4 dependencies: - atom-languageclient: 1.10.0 + atom-languageclient: 1.14.1 atom-package-deps: 7.2.3 fs-extra: 10.0.0 semver: 7.3.5 @@ -413,6 +413,11 @@ packages: /@types/node/14.14.41: resolution: {integrity: sha512-dueRKfaJL4RTtSa7bWeTK1M+VH+Gns73oCgzvYfHZywRCoPSd8EkXBL0mZ9unPTveBn+D9phZBaxuzpwjWkW0g==} + dev: true + + /@types/node/15.14.2: + resolution: {integrity: sha512-dvMUE/m2LbXPwlvVuzCyslTEtQ2ZwuuFClDrOQ6mp2CenCg971719PTILZ4I6bTP27xfFFc+o7x2TkLuun/MPw==} + dev: false /@types/node/15.6.0: resolution: {integrity: sha512-gCYSfQpy+LYhOFTKAeE8BkyGqaxmlFxe+n4DKM6DR0wzw/HISUE/hAmkC/KT8Sw5PCJblqg062b3z9gucv3k0A==} @@ -421,14 +426,14 @@ packages: resolution: {integrity: sha512-KfRL3PuHmqQLOG+2tGpRO26Ctg+Cq1E01D2DMriKEATHgWLfeNDmq9e29Q9WIky0dQ3NPkd1mzYH8Lm936Z9qw==} dev: false - /@types/react-dom/17.0.5: - resolution: {integrity: sha512-ikqukEhH4H9gr4iJCmQVNzTB307kROe3XFfHAOTxOXPOw7lAoEXnM5KWTkzeANGL5Ce6ABfiMl/zJBYNi7ObmQ==} + /@types/react-dom/17.0.9: + resolution: {integrity: sha512-wIvGxLfgpVDSAMH5utdL9Ngm5Owu0VsGmldro3ORLXV8CShrL8awVj06NuEXFQ5xyaYfdca7Sgbk/50Ri1GdPg==} dependencies: - '@types/react': 17.0.6 + '@types/react': 17.0.14 dev: false - /@types/react/17.0.6: - resolution: {integrity: sha512-u/TtPoF/hrvb63LdukET6ncaplYsvCvmkceasx8oG84/ZCsoLxz9Z/raPBP4lTAiWW1Jb889Y9svHmv8R26dWw==} + /@types/react/17.0.14: + resolution: {integrity: sha512-0WwKHUbWuQWOce61UexYuWTGuGY/8JvtUe/dtQ6lR4sZ3UiylHotJeWpf3ArP9+DSGUoLY3wbU59VyMrJps5VQ==} dependencies: '@types/prop-types': 15.7.3 '@types/scheduler': 0.16.1 @@ -441,8 +446,8 @@ packages: '@types/node': 14.14.41 dev: true - /@types/rimraf/3.0.0: - resolution: {integrity: sha512-7WhJ0MdpFgYQPXlF4Dx+DhgvlPCfz/x5mHaeDQAKhcenvQP1KCpLQ18JklAqeGMYSAT2PxLpzd0g2/HE7fj7hQ==} + /@types/rimraf/3.0.1: + resolution: {integrity: sha512-CAoSlbco40aKZ0CkelBF2g3JeN6aioRaTVnqSX5pWsn/WApm6IDxI4e4tD9D0dY/meCkyyleP1IQDVN13F4maA==} dependencies: '@types/glob': 7.1.3 '@types/node': 15.6.0 @@ -737,20 +742,19 @@ packages: resolution: {integrity: sha1-7GphrlZIDAw8skHJVhjiCJL5Zyo=} dev: true - /atom-ide-base/2.6.0: - resolution: {integrity: sha512-ZdRehC6FxVYhKJekja4tIT8EAqPQUlNnTtYi5825K/+mP6M6exzLKXzi30okoOopXW68k8X2COIZXTU1/r+Osg==} + /atom-ide-base/3.3.0: + resolution: {integrity: sha512-sAlYapfh0WbsRKnO0xlzggWY0X/j3XwoAAVrq9h+TpHc81O/TihRWsC2TPXhMoIWVKq40XASgqIXkN8kxDkoWA==} engines: {atom: '>=0.174.0 <2.0.0', pnpm: '>=5.12'} dependencies: '@types/atom': 1.40.10 '@types/dompurify': 2.2.2 - '@types/node': 14.14.41 - '@types/react': 17.0.6 - '@types/react-dom': 17.0.5 + '@types/node': 15.14.2 + '@types/react': 17.0.14 + '@types/react-dom': 17.0.9 atom-ide-markdown-service: 2.1.0 atom-package-deps: 7.2.3 classnames: 2.3.1 - dompurify: 2.2.8 - etch: 0.14.1 + dompurify: 2.3.0 react: 17.0.2 react-dom: 17.0.2_react@17.0.2 rxjs: 6.6.7 @@ -760,7 +764,7 @@ packages: resolution: {integrity: sha512-tbOMGVwOHgAwY8scx2maimConxQLKaFYEsaUs8sqOd9FVMGiulxg3XG0IGrhpdxd8nM3QqZLmFFX4fUExqe3UA==} engines: {atom: '>=1.0.0 <2.0.0'} dependencies: - dompurify: 2.2.8 + dompurify: 2.3.0 marked: 1.2.9 dev: false @@ -788,16 +792,16 @@ packages: '@types/jasmine': 3.7.4 dev: true - /atom-languageclient/1.10.0: - resolution: {integrity: sha512-+LqtHOkEIXFDwQofyHhJ9VPF7IY4zMhvSl26qRUxhDn/02BGjzTmBSIULwScWK+97iKaYwSUKTbJCQP4+rmmBw==} + /atom-languageclient/1.14.1: + resolution: {integrity: sha512-eWjY3BzAlyzzkvJGOuBOyCB9TS9IVwrioN+xYJpEz371UfuwRd7e2P9BKKN+LEiJMKG0p5hndHIEf57+nBPaIw==} dependencies: - '@types/rimraf': 3.0.0 - atom-ide-base: 2.6.0 + '@types/rimraf': 3.0.1 + atom-ide-base: 3.3.0 rimraf: 3.0.2 vscode-jsonrpc: 6.0.0 vscode-languageserver-protocol: 3.16.0 vscode-languageserver-types: 3.16.0 - zadeh: 3.0.0-beta.2 + zadeh: 3.0.0-beta.4 dev: false /atom-package-deps/7.2.3: @@ -904,12 +908,6 @@ packages: resolution: {integrity: sha512-H0ea4Fd3lS1+sTEB2TgcLoK21lLhwEJzlQv3IN47pJS976Gx4zoWe0ak3q+uYh60ppQxg9F16Ri4tS1sfD4+jA==} dev: true - /bindings/1.5.0: - resolution: {integrity: sha512-p2q/t/mhvuOj/UeLlV6566GD/guowlr0hHxClI0W9m7MWYkL1F0hLo+0Aexs9HSPCtR1SXQ0TD3MMKrXZajbiQ==} - dependencies: - file-uri-to-path: 1.0.0 - dev: false - /bl/1.2.3: resolution: {integrity: sha512-pvcNpa0UU69UT341rO6AYy4FVAIkUHuZXRIWbq+zHnsVcRzDDjIAhGuuYoi0d//cwIwtt4pkpKycWEfjdV+vww==} dependencies: @@ -1392,8 +1390,8 @@ packages: domelementtype: 2.2.0 dev: true - /dompurify/2.2.8: - resolution: {integrity: sha512-9H0UL59EkDLgY3dUFjLV6IEUaHm5qp3mxSqWw7Yyx4Zhk2Jn2cmLe+CNPP3xy13zl8Bqg+0NehQzkdMoVhGRww==} + /dompurify/2.3.0: + resolution: {integrity: sha512-VV5C6Kr53YVHGOBKO/F86OYX6/iLTw2yVSI721gKetxpHCK/V5TaLEf9ODjRgl1KLSWRMY6cUhAbv/c+IUnwQw==} dev: false /domutils/1.5.1: @@ -1857,6 +1855,7 @@ packages: /etch/0.14.1: resolution: {integrity: sha512-+IwqSDBhaQFMUHJu4L/ir0dhDoW5IIihg4Z9lzsIxxne8V0PlSg0gnk2STaKWjGJQnDR4cxpA+a/dORX9kycTA==} + dev: true /event-kit/2.5.3: resolution: {integrity: sha512-b7Qi1JNzY4BfAYfnIRanLk0DOD1gdkWHT4GISIn8Q2tAf3LpU8SP2CMwWaq40imYoKWbtN4ZhbSRxvsnikooZQ==} @@ -1944,10 +1943,6 @@ packages: engines: {node: '>=4'} dev: true - /file-uri-to-path/1.0.0: - resolution: {integrity: sha512-0Zt+s3L7Vf1biwWZ29aARiVYLx7iMGnEUl9x33fbB/j3jR81u/O2LbqK+Bm1CDSNDKVtJ/YjwY7TUd5SkeLQLw==} - dev: false - /fill-range/7.0.1: resolution: {integrity: sha512-qOo9F+dMUmC2Lcb4BbVvnKJxTPjCm+RRpe4gDuGrzkL7mEVl/djYSu2OdQ2Pa302N4oqkSg9ir6jaLWJ2USVpQ==} engines: {node: '>=8'} @@ -2114,6 +2109,7 @@ packages: minimatch: 3.0.4 once: 1.4.0 path-is-absolute: 1.0.1 + dev: true /glob/7.1.7: resolution: {integrity: sha512-OvD9ENzPLbegENnYP5UUfJIirTg4+XwMWGaQfQTY0JenxNvvIKP3U3/tAQSPIu/lHxXYSZmpXlUHeqAIdKzBLQ==} @@ -2124,7 +2120,6 @@ packages: minimatch: 3.0.4 once: 1.4.0 path-is-absolute: 1.0.1 - dev: true /globals/11.12.0: resolution: {integrity: sha512-WOBp/EEGUiIsJSp7wcv/y6MO+lV9UoncWqxuFfm8eBwzWNgyfBd6Gz+IeKQ9jCmyhoH99g15M3T+QaVHFjizVA==} @@ -2901,8 +2896,8 @@ packages: sax: 1.2.4 dev: true - /node-addon-api/3.1.0: - resolution: {integrity: sha512-flmrDNB06LIl5lywUz7YlNGZH/5p0M7W28k8hzd9Lshtdh1wshD2Y+U4h9LD6KObOy1f+fEVdgprPrEymjM5uw==} + /node-addon-api/4.0.0: + resolution: {integrity: sha512-ALmRVBFzfwldBfk3SbKfl6+PVMXiCPKZBEfsJqB/EjXAMAI+MfFrEHR+GMRBuI162DihZ1QjEZ8ieYKuRCJ8Hg==} dev: false /node-gyp-build/4.2.3: @@ -3435,7 +3430,7 @@ packages: resolution: {integrity: sha512-JZkJMZkAGFFPP2YqXZXPbMlMBgsxzE8ILs4lMIX/2o0L9UBw9O/Y3o6wFw/i9YLapcUJWwqbi3kdxIPdC62TIA==} hasBin: true dependencies: - glob: 7.1.6 + glob: 7.1.7 /run-parallel/1.1.10: resolution: {integrity: sha512-zb/1OuZ6flOlH6tQyMPUrE3x3Ulxjlo9WIVXR4yVYi4H9UXQaeIsPbLn2R3O3vQCnDKkAl2qHiuocKKX4Tz/Sw==} @@ -4028,11 +4023,11 @@ packages: engines: {node: '>=6'} dev: true - /zadeh/3.0.0-beta.2: - resolution: {integrity: sha512-HHLvrzoeegMkuXaXrQUlQJVRTM2nl23g/obw0ENfMu+xQL+VJA3SQl7cQ73btyUNAQZsrWf9FMegbVLLHOhORg==} + /zadeh/3.0.0-beta.4: + resolution: {integrity: sha512-tl65LekkDnEj2FPX7Bgx8uz0rXOP+UBTgGN7nva7uwX+9lOe4ECuQCeBr40ajHUwW+oJ50vusbnxjdkI/mmiqw==} + engines: {atom: '>=1.52.0 <2.0.0', electron: '>=6.0.0', node: '>=12.0.0'} requiresBuild: true dependencies: - bindings: 1.5.0 - node-addon-api: 3.1.0 + node-addon-api: 4.0.0 node-gyp-build: 4.2.3 dev: false